Segregation is the term the Assessor and Tax Collector uses to describe the separation of a single tax bill which then becomes prorated among individual owners. Prorate comes from the Latin phrase pro rata which roughly translates to proportionally. When it comes to real estate, you'll likely hear the term used to talk about the breakdown and division of expenses based on the proportion of the year that a certain party owned or rented a property. A map, plan or lot line adjustment in a new subdivision that records prior to December 31st will cause the segregation by the following tax year. Typically, the owner of the building will take the annual expenses for each of the common areas and divide it by the amount of rental-eligible square footage in the building. In addition to segregation, an increase in the assessed value due to a change in ownership and new construction can be under review with the Assessor during sales to individual buyers, causing a change in assessed value after bills have been issued and resulting in additional bills issued after sales.
